6.6 sFlow®
Proxim point-to-multipoint and point-to-point devices support sFlow® technology, developed by InMon Corporation. The
sFlow® technology provides the ability to measure network traffic on all interfaces simultaneously by collecting, storing, and
analyzing traffic data.
Depicted below is the sFlow architecture that consists of a sFlow Agent and a sFlow Receiver.
The sFlow Agent, which is running on devices, captures traffic information received on all the Ethernet interfaces, and sends
sampled packets to the sFlow Receiver for analysis.
The sampling mechanism used to sample data are as follows:
Packet Flow Sampling: In this sampling, the data packets received on the Ethernet interface of the device are
sampled based on a counter. With each packet received, the counter is decremented. When the counter reaches zero,
the packet is packaged and sent to the sFlow Receiver for analysis. These packets are referred to as Packet Flow
Samples.
Counter Polling Sampling: In this sampling, the sFlow Agent sends counters periodically to the sFlow Receiver based
on the set polling interval. If polling interval is set to 5 seconds then the sFlow Agent sends counters to sFlow Receiver
every 5 seconds. These packets are referred to as Counter Polling Samples.
The Packet Flow Samples and Counter Polling Samples are collectively sent to the sFlow Receiver as sFlow Datagrams. It is
possible to enable either or both types of sampling.
sFlow Sampling effects the system performance and hence care must be taken in configuring the sFlow parameters.
To configure sFlow, navigate to MONITOR > Tools > sFlow. Following information is displayed about the sFlow Agent:
Version: The version comprises the following information:
1. sFlow MIB Version: Indicates the agent's MIB version. The MIB specifies how the agent extracts and bundles
sampled data, and the sFlow receiver must support the agent's MIB. For example, if the sFlow MIB version is 1.3,
the sFlow Receiver's version must also be at least 1.3.
2. Organization: Specifies the organization implementing sFlow Agent functionality on the device. For example
Proxim Wireless Corp.
3. Revision: Specifies the sFlow Agent version. For example v6.4.
Address Type: Specifies the protocol version for IP addresses.
Agent Address: Specifies the sFlow Agent's IP address.
